Oil getting dirty relatively fast.
I know this sounds like a silly newb question but, I have never changed oil in a car so much as I have in my high performance 240, ha. In doing so, I have found that the oil gets dirty really fast. For instance, after a short break in period of 100+- miles, the oil was not clear at all, it looked like it had 1000 miles on the oil. this is after a brand new filter, no carbon or old oil anywhere in the motor, basically a fresh motor. Is this normal? I did recently pull the valve cover off and the head looked nice and clean and the puddles of oil in valleys and crevices looked not that bad but definitely dirty, this is after 500+- miles. Normal or not?
